首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

php数据库模板下载

基础概念

PHP是一种广泛使用的开源脚本语言,尤其适用于Web开发。它可以嵌入HTML中,使得动态网页内容的生成变得简单。数据库模板则是一种预先设计好的数据库结构,它可以帮助开发者快速搭建数据库,减少重复工作。

相关优势

  1. 提高开发效率:使用数据库模板可以快速搭建数据库结构,减少手动编写SQL语句的时间。
  2. 标准化设计:模板通常遵循一定的设计规范,有助于保持数据库设计的一致性和可维护性。
  3. 降低错误率:预设计的模板减少了因手动编写SQL而可能引入的错误。

类型

数据库模板通常分为以下几类:

  1. 关系型数据库模板:如MySQL、PostgreSQL等。
  2. NoSQL数据库模板:如MongoDB、Redis等。

应用场景

  • Web应用:用于存储用户信息、文章内容等。
  • 电子商务系统:用于管理商品、订单等信息。
  • 社交网络:用于存储用户资料、好友关系等。

常见问题及解决方法

问题1:如何下载PHP数据库模板?

答:可以通过以下几种方式下载PHP数据库模板:

  1. 开源社区:许多开源项目会在GitHub等平台上提供数据库模板,可以直接下载使用。
  2. 专业网站:一些专门提供数据库模板的网站,如Database Answers等,可以找到所需的模板。
  3. 自行编写:根据具体需求,自行编写数据库结构和SQL语句。

问题2:下载的模板如何使用?

答:下载的模板通常包含数据库结构和初始化数据。使用步骤如下:

  1. 导入数据库结构:将模板中的SQL文件导入到目标数据库中。例如,在MySQL中可以使用以下命令:
  2. 导入数据库结构:将模板中的SQL文件导入到目标数据库中。例如,在MySQL中可以使用以下命令:
  3. 配置PHP连接:在PHP代码中配置数据库连接信息,连接到导入的数据库。例如:
  4. 配置PHP连接:在PHP代码中配置数据库连接信息,连接到导入的数据库。例如:

问题3:模板中的数据如何处理?

答:模板中的数据通常是初始化数据,用于测试和演示。在实际使用中,可以根据需要进行修改或删除。如果需要导入大量数据,可以使用批量插入的方式提高效率。

示例代码

以下是一个简单的PHP连接MySQL数据库的示例代码:

代码语言:txt
复制
<?php
$servername = "localhost";
$username = "username";
$password = "password";
$dbname = "database_name";

// 创建连接
$conn = new mysqli($servername, $username, $password, $dbname);

// 检测连接
if ($conn->connect_error) {
    die("连接失败: " . $conn->connect_error);
}
echo "连接成功";

// 查询数据
$sql = "SELECT id, name FROM users";
$result = $conn->query($sql);

if ($result->num_rows > 0) {
    // 输出数据
    while($row = $result->fetch_assoc()) {
        echo "id: " . $row["id"]. " - Name: " . $row["name"]. "<br>";
    }
} else {
    echo "0 结果";
}
$conn->close();
?>

参考链接

通过以上信息,您可以更好地理解PHP数据库模板的概念、优势、类型和应用场景,并解决常见的使用问题。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• php jquery教程下载,jquery 怎么下载

    下载jquery的方法:首先使用百度搜索“jQuery”;然后点击进入jQuery网站;最后找到适合开发的版本后进行下载即可。...下载jquery的方法: 首先,打开您的浏览器,无论是什么浏览器都可以,只要可以连接上网络就行。 使用百度搜索“jQuery”. 您可以选择下图所示量项中的一项,并点击进入jQuery网站。...点击上图所示的内容后,您可进入到下图所示页面: 页面中有很多的内容可以供您选择,你可以根据您的需求来进行下载。 在上图所示的内容中,找到适合您开发的版本后进行下载。...jQuery网站上有一些关于jQuery的介绍,您可以在网站上查看内容,确定是否符合您的要求: 下载下来后,您就可以使用jQuery了。

    9.4K20

    php实现文件下载

    近期搞了一个安卓的客户端,想把它挂到站点上提供下载,整理实现思路如下: (1).浏览器发送一个请求,请求访问服务器中的某个网页(如:down.php)       (2).运行该文件的时候...,必然要把将要被下载的文件读入内存当中,通过fopen()函数完成该动作        (3).从内存当中读取文件,通过fread()函数完成该动作  (4).把读到的内容输出到客户端...所以我们需要在php代码中设置一次读取的字节数,比如我在下面的代码中通过$buffer=1024设置一次读取的字节数,每读取一次,就输出数据(即返回给浏览器)   具体实现如下,我把代码贴出来,代码都做了详细的注释.../admin.php?s=."/Uploads/DownFile/"; $file_path=$file_sub_path....fopen($file_path,"r"); //以只读的方式打开文件 $file_size=filesize($file_path);//得到文件大小 //下载文件需要用到的头

    21120

    PHP八大模板引擎

    当我们在PHP中讨论模板引擎时,许多开发人员会告诉你,这是没有必要的,他们会说这是学习时间和资源的浪费,因为PHP本质上也是一个模板引擎。...{{/in_ca}} Plates plates是一个原生PHP模板系统,快速,易于使用,易于扩展是它的特性。它受到出色的 Twig 模板引擎的启发,并努力将现代模板语言功能引入 PHP 模板中。...此模板引擎具有: 原生的 PHP 模板,无需学习新语法 plates是模板系统,而不是模板语言 plates鼓励使用现有的PHP函数 通过模板布局和继承增加代码重用 用于将模板分组到命名空间的模板文件夹...php endif ?> Blade blade是laravel内置的模板引擎。与其他流行的PHP模板引擎不同,Blade 不会限制您在视图中使用纯 PHP 代码。...这意味着PHP代码是应用程序逻辑,并且与表示分离。Smarty 将模板的副本编译为 PHP 脚本。通过这种方式,您可以获得模板标记语法和 PHP 速度的优点。

    67520

    20000套国外PPT模板免费下载

    Hi~各位朋友早上好 今天小编给大家偷偷分享一个我收藏了多年的PPT网站,这个网站主要以分享国外ppt,key,gslides模板为主,目前已经收录20000多套模板,包含了多种不同格式的模板,多种不同于样式与类型的...:创意图形模板,数据图表,商务模板,卡通插画......等等,模板数量太多了无法一句话描述。...,并且质量非常高,虽然大家平时很少接触到此类模板,但是这类模板是兼容PPT软件的: gsl_01.jpg gsl_02.jpg gsl_03.jpg gsl_04.jpg 模板的从配色到版式再到图形的设计都非常出彩...,很多模板都是一套模板包含多种配色与多种尺寸,全方位拯救职场小白,让你PPT大放光彩。...这么多好模板,我们要去哪里下载呢,这个网站就是“顶尖PPT”一个以分享国外顶尖,时尚PPT,keynote为主的网站,如果对这些模板感兴趣,赶紧去下载吧! 顶尖PPT:www.gfxaa.com

    6.9K30

    简记siteserver远程模板下载Getshell漏洞

    到此,就发现了后门webshell的攻击路径,通过远程下载模板的方式,将后门webshell打包成压缩文件zip,而压缩文件会自动解压,所以造成aspx文件可以执行,此过程类似于tomcat上传war包...代码审计 0x0a 漏洞概述 通过了解,得知被攻击的网站使用的是siteserver cms,为开源免费cms框架,官网https://www.siteserver.cn/,捕获到的“0 day”是通过远程模板下载...getshell,漏洞缺陷是由于后台模板下载位置未对用户权限进行校验,且 ajaxOtherService中的downloadUrl参数可控,导致getshell,目前经过测试发现对5.0版本包含5.0...参数值的相关功能,其中最重要的一步操作就是此时先调用了DecryptStringBySecretKey函数将downloadurl先进行了解密,之后调用SiteTemplateDownload函数进行模板下载并自解压...ZjYIub0slash0YxA3QempkVBK4CoiVo3M607H0slash0TBf7F0aPcUE0equals0&directoryName=txt2 在浏览器访问自己搭建的测试网站使用url,发现提示模板下载成功

    2.9K10
    领券